14:5 And it was told the king that the people fled - He either forgot, or would not own that they had departed with his consent; and therefore was willing it should be represented to him as a revolt from their allegiance.
14:7 Captains over every one of them - Or rather over all of them; distributing the command of them to his several Captains.
14:8 With an high hand - Boldly, resolutely.
